Metal stud offers several advantages compared to wood. This is because of its characteristics. First, metal stud is lighter in weight. It is also generally more straight than a wooden profile. As a result, it does not need to be filled up, and a metal stud frame can be built faster than a wooden one. Steel profiles do not warp, unlike wood. Also, the standards of metal stud profiles contain factory-made openings for the passage of pipes.

A metal stud wall is a non-load bearing wall. This means that the wall cannot support any weight. It is just a frame for the partition system that will be built.

U-profiles determine the location for C-profiles and lock them in place, so to speak. Above and below the C-profiles, U-profiles are placed as support beams. This applies to both wall and ceiling profiles. All our C-profiles have an extra edge on the side of the profile. This makes them more stable and they do not bend when screwing the wall plates to the built-up frame. With our C60-27 ceiling profile – with the ceiling tiles being screwed to the back of the profile – the edge serves as an extra support against bending.

In most cases, a C60-27 profile. Either as a single or double grid or in combination with U27 or U27-50 edge profiles. If necessary, fittings are added for suspension from the overhead deck. A metal stud ceiling can also be made with C- and U-wall profiles..

A metal stud ceiling – depending on the length of the profiles and whether they have a single or double grid – is suspended from the overhead deck with fittings developed for this purpose. The number, spacing and type (in connection with the bearing strength) depends on the total weight of the ceiling construction.

In case of a double grid, a primary layer of metal stud profiles is applied, which are suspended from the overhead deck. The second layer of profiles is applied at right angles to the primary profiles. This is below the primary layer. Using cross connectors, the second layer is attached to the primary layer. The ceiling tiles are attached to this.
